I don’t understand the value in hoarding. OT psychs need to explain.



A lot of it came from the Great Depression. People had literally nothing. They lived in ramshackle huts. My grandfather had everything he owned as a boy in a cigar box. They would have to move a lot for work, or if they couldn’t pay the rent, sometimes in the middle of the night. Times were hard, real hard.

So he decided when he grew up, he never wanted to HAVE to move, and never wanted to HAVE to throw anything away.

He wasn’t a hoarder really, but he had sheds full of just stuff. But that’s where the mentality came from

It's usually instigated by some kind of life trauma..usually the loss of a loved one. The hoarding is something they can control. It's not about the things as much as it is controlling their life. The things come to symbolize control and security.
